HB 451 Inmate Reentry Services (2018 Session)
Inmate Reentry Services: Requires DOC to allow nonprofit organizations to provide inmate reentry services; requires DOC to adopt policies & procedures for screening, approving, & registering those nonprofit organizations; prohibits DOC from endorsing or sponsoring any faith-based reentry program, endorsing any specific religious message, or requiring inmate to participate in faith-based program. Effective Date: October 1, 2018
